Type: Heirloom
Packet size: 20 seeds
Solanum lycopersicum. Watermelon Beefsteak Tomato is a striking heirloom variety that produces large, pink beefsteak fruits with exceptional flavor and impressive size. The smooth, rosy-pink tomatoes often weigh 1β2 pounds and feature juicy, meaty flesh with few seeds. Known for its sweet, rich flavor and excellent texture, Watermelon Beefsteak is perfect for slicing, sandwiches, salads, and fresh eating. Vigorous indeterminate plants provide abundant harvests of giant tomatoes throughout the growing season.
π± Growing Information
How to Grow Watermelon Beefsteak Tomato from Seed
Planting Depth: 1/4 inch
Seed Spacing: Start indoors in trays or pots
Row Spacing: 36β48 inches
Germination Time: 7β14 days
Days to Harvest: 80β90 days
Sun Requirements: Full Sun
Planting Tips:
Start seeds indoors 6β8 weeks before your last expected frost date. Maintain soil temperatures between 70β85Β°F for optimal germination. Transplant outdoors after all danger of frost has passed. Plant deeply to encourage strong root development and provide sturdy cages or stakes to support the vigorous vines and heavy fruits. Water consistently throughout the season and mulch around plants to help retain moisture. Harvest fruits when they develop a rich pink color and feel slightly soft for the best flavor and texture.
